For starting a saree collection to pass down — the first heirloom for the next generation — this beautifully composed pure silk Kanchipuram saree is woven in the Korvai style. Body and border woven separately and structurally interlocked on the loom. Each saree takes 45 days from dyeing to weaving and cannot be replicated by machine. The saturated violet body is scattered with prominent circular zari medallion buttas — their rounded, coin-like silhouettes containing intricate traditional detailing, creating luminous gold accents against the uninterrupted expanse of violet silk.
The border shifts into a softer lavender-grey silk, allowing the broad gold zari work to glow without competing with the body colour — ornamental floral and traditional figurative detailing is woven into the zari, framed by fine geometric edging for a polished finish.

| Weave | Korvai |
| Body | Royal violet pure mulberry silk with large circular medallion-style zari buttas |
| Border | Lavender-grey border, ornamental floral and figurative detailing in gold zari |
| Pallu | Lavender-grey pallu continuing the border's gold zari ornamental motifs |
| Blouse | 0.8m, self-colour lavender-grey silk |
| Length | 6.3m total |
| Origin | Kunnam village, Kanchipuram district, Tamil Nadu |
| Silk Mark | Certified |
